The Missing Link to Personal Safety

When it comes to personal safety and self-defense, it is important to remember that "one size does not fit all." While there is some common sense advice we all can benefit from, a more personalized body-mind approach to Personal Safety will help you gain the security and the confidence you are looking for. How do you personalize your training to overcome a stronger and more forceful attacker? The first step is to assess a potentially dangerous situation from a realistic point of view.

Traditional self-defense programs are taught with the best of intentions, but in hindsight neglect some important elements that make those programs useless. If you don’t question the advice given you will find yourself in the “victim”-position once again. Revat is new, revolutionary and different because its practitioners (men and women, professionals and even martial arts experts) follow two rules that are neglected by other programs.

The first rule of self-defense is that the attacker is always stronger. This needs no explanation and can be categorized as ‘common sense’. Nobody will ever attack someone who is stronger than they are. After all, you are supposed to be the “victim” and not a challenge. This first rule is the reason why any joint locks, wrestling moves or even any blocks never work in real life.

The second rule of self-defense is that you only have a couple to seconds to react and defend the attack. Anybody who has ever been attacked knows that; the attack is over before you realize what just happened. Therefore, you need to train your reflexes and not techniques. Techniques are something you have to remember; some times they work many times they don’t. Reflexes always work; you don’t have to think about what to do when you touch a hot stove. You automatically and instinctively know what to do in order to protect yourself from more pain. Of course, you need to train your reflexes properly so they can respond accordingly. Self-defense is a skill that can be learned by anyone and Revat makes the training easy and fun yet highly effective. Revat utilizes a very specific “Reflex Training” that allows the practitioner to feel the power and the direction of an attack. In addition, the Revat practitioner then uses the energy of the attack to move his body out of the way and deflects the attack almost effortlessly. The simultaneous execution of defense and counter attack by the practitioner enables him or her to control the fight and end it before it escalates. A self-defense situation is not a competition. There are no rules, time limits and weight classes. The situation has to be brought under control and ended quickly in order to avoid any injuries.
